#main_nav {
	width: 535px;
	margin: 0 auto;
	height: 32px;
	background-repeat: no-repeat;
}

#main_nav ul  { 
	margin:0; 
	list-style: none; 
	padding: 0; 
	display: inline;
	width: 540px;
}

#main_nav li { 
	text-decoration: none; 
	float: left; 
	list-style-type: none; 
}

#main_nav li a.idle {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
}


#main_nav li a.idle:hover {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	background-position-y: -31px;
}

#main_nav li a.active {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position-y: -62px;
}

#main_nav li a.home {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	background-position: 0px 0px;
	height: 32px;
	width: 55px;
}

#main_nav li a.home_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	background-position: 0px -62px;
	height: 32px;
	width: 55px;
}

#main_nav li a.home:hover {  
	background-position: 0px -31px;
}

#main_nav li a.trailer {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-55px 0px;
	height: 32px;
	width: 71px;
}

#main_nav li a.trailer_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-55px -62px;
	height: 32px;
	width: 71px;
}

#main_nav li a.trailer:hover {  
	background-position: -55px -31px;
}

#main_nav li a.cinemas {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-126px 0px;
	height: 32px;
	width: 74px;
}

#main_nav li a.cinemas_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-126px -62px;
	height: 32px;
	width: 74px;
}

#main_nav li a.cinemas:hover {  
	background-position: -126px -31px;
}

#main_nav li a.dvd {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-200px 0px;
	height: 32px;
	width: 117px;
}

#main_nav li a.dvd_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-200px -62px;
	height: 32px;
	width: 117px;
}

#main_nav li a.dvd:hover {  
	background-position: -200px -31px;
}

#main_nav li a.images {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-317px 0px;
	height: 32px;
	width: 66px;
}

#main_nav li a.images_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-317px -62px;
	height: 32px;
	width: 66px;
}

#main_nav li a.images:hover {  
	background-position: -317px -31px;
}

#main_nav li a.events {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-383px 0px;
	height: 32px;
	width: 68px;
}

#main_nav li a.events_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-383px -62px;
	height: 32px;
	width: 68px;
}

#main_nav li a.events:hover {  
	background-position: -383px -31px;
}

#main_nav li a.about {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-451px 0px;
	height: 32px;
	width: 61px;
}

#main_nav li a.about_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-451px -62px;
	height: 32px;
	width: 61px;
}

#main_nav li a.about:hover {  
	background-position: -451px -31px;
}

#main_nav li a.comp {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-512px 0px;
	height: 32px;
	width: 106px;
}

#main_nav li a.comp_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-512px -62px;
	height: 32px;
	width: 106px;
}

#main_nav li a.comp:hover {  
	background-position: -512px -31px;
}

#main_nav li a.links {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-618px 0px;
	height: 32px;
	width: 57px;
}

#main_nav li a.links_s {  
	display: block;
	color: white;
	background-image: url(../images/tysonNav2.jpg);
	background-repeat: no-repeat;
	height: 32px;
	background-position: -618px -62px;
	height: 32px;
	width: 57px;
}

#main_nav li a.links:hover {  
	background-position: -618px -31px;
}





#footer_navContainer {
	margin: 0 auto;
	background-repeat: no-repeat;
	background-image: url(../images/footer_whiteLine.jpg);
	background-repeat: no-repeat;
	background-position: center top;
	background-color: black;
	text-align: center;
	width: 100%;
	padding: 15px 0px;
}


#footer_nav_blu {
	margin: 0 auto;
	height: 24px;
	width: 407px;
	background-image: url(../images/footerNav_blu.gif);
	background-repeat: no-repeat;
}

#footer_nav_blu ul  { 
	margin:0; 
	list-style: none; 
	padding: 0; 
	display: inline;
	height: 24px;
}

#footer_nav_blu li { 
	text-decoration: none; 
	float: left; 
	list-style-type: none; 
}

#footer_nav_blu li a.play {  
	display: block;
	height: 24px;
	width: 92px;
	margin-left: 197px;
}

#footer_nav_blu li a.play:hover {  
	display: block;
	height: 24px;
	width: 92px;
	margin-left: 197px;
	background-image: url(../images/footerNav_blu.gif);
	background-position: -197px -24px;
}

#footer_nav_blu li a.hmv {  
	display: block;
	height: 24px;
	width: 44px;
}

#footer_nav_blu li a.hmv:hover {  
	display: block;
	height: 24px;
	width: 44px;
	background-image: url(../images/footerNav_blu.gif);
	background-position: -289px -24px;
}

#footer_nav_blu li a.amazon {  
	display: block;
	height: 24px;
	width: 74px;
}

#footer_nav_blu li a.amazon:hover {  
	display: block;
	height: 24px;
	width: 74px;
	background-image: url(../images/footerNav_blu.gif);
	background-position: -333px -24px;
}




#footer_nav_dvd {
	margin: 0 auto;
	height: 24px;
	width: 407px;
	background-image: url(../images/footerNav_dvd.gif);
	background-repeat: no-repeat;
}

#footer_nav_dvd ul  { 
	margin:0; 
	list-style: none; 
	padding: 0; 
	display: inline;
	height: 24px;
}

#footer_nav_dvd li { 
	text-decoration: none; 
	float: left; 
	list-style-type: none; 
}

#footer_nav_dvd li a.play {  
	display: block;
	height: 24px;
	width: 92px;
	margin-left: 197px;
}

#footer_nav_dvd li a.play:hover {  
	display: block;
	height: 24px;
	width: 92px;
	margin-left: 197px;
	background-image: url(../images/footerNav_dvd.gif);
	background-position: -197px -24px;
}

#footer_nav_dvd li a.hmv {  
	display: block;
	height: 24px;
	width: 44px;
}

#footer_nav_dvd li a.hmv:hover {  
	display: block;
	height: 24px;
	width: 44px;
	background-image: url(../images/footerNav_dvd.gif);
	background-position: -289px -24px;
}

#footer_nav_dvd li a.amazon {  
	display: block;
	height: 24px;
	width: 74px;
}

#footer_nav_dvd li a.amazon:hover {  
	display: block;
	height: 24px;
	width: 74px;
	background-image: url(../images/footerNav_dvd.gif);
	background-position: -333px -24px;
}


